diff options
author | cyberta <cyberta@riseup.net> | 2021-08-02 23:16:02 +0200 |
---|---|---|
committer | cyberta <cyberta@riseup.net> | 2021-08-02 23:16:02 +0200 |
commit | f7e3428d40ada6a482f5c1b02a299d1f92a29be6 (patch) | |
tree | 8efa339d148eef65cab6d6ba21f15513f7de8cd8 | |
parent | a5f118a494ad3f8959a1790f7674376885b650c3 (diff) |
try to install docker according to the docs
-rw-r--r-- | docker/android-emulator/Dockerfile | 6 | ||||
-rw-r--r-- | docker/android-ndk/Dockerfile | 6 | ||||
-rw-r--r-- | docker/android-sdk/Dockerfile | 6 |
3 files changed, 12 insertions, 6 deletions
diff --git a/docker/android-emulator/Dockerfile b/docker/android-emulator/Dockerfile index 09bc99de..d5349da1 100644 --- a/docker/android-emulator/Dockerfile +++ b/docker/android-emulator/Dockerfile @@ -15,8 +15,10 @@ ENV ANDROID_EMULATOR_USE_SYSTEM_LIBS=1 RUN apt-get update -qq && \ apt-get -y dist-upgrade && \ apt-get -y install gnupg apt-transport-https -RUN echo 'deb https://download.docker.com/linux/debian debian-stretch stable' > /etc/apt/sources.list.d/docker.list && \ - curl -s https://download.docker.com/linux/debian/gpg | apt-key add - +RUN curl -fsSL https://download.docker.com/linux/debian/gpg | sudo gpg --dearmor -o /usr/share/keyrings/docker-archive-keyring.gpg && \ + echo \ + "deb [arch=amd64 signed-by=/usr/share/keyrings/docker-archive-keyring.gpg] https://download.docker.com/linux/debian \ + $(lsb_release -cs) stable" | sudo tee /etc/apt/sources.list.d/docker.list > /dev/null RUN apt-get update -qq && \ apt-get -y install docker-engine mesa-utils && \ apt-get clean && \ diff --git a/docker/android-ndk/Dockerfile b/docker/android-ndk/Dockerfile index c60f0f15..0663916b 100644 --- a/docker/android-ndk/Dockerfile +++ b/docker/android-ndk/Dockerfile @@ -12,8 +12,10 @@ ENV DEBIAN_FRONTEND noninteractive RUN apt-get update -qq && \ apt-get -y dist-upgrade && \ apt-get install -y gnupg apt-transport-https -RUN echo 'deb https://download.docker.com/linux/debian debian-stretch stable' > /etc/apt/sources.list.d/docker.list && \ - curl -s https://download.docker.com/linux/debian/gpg | apt-key add - +RUN curl -fsSL https://download.docker.com/linux/debian/gpg | sudo gpg --dearmor -o /usr/share/keyrings/docker-archive-keyring.gpg && \ + echo \ + "deb [arch=amd64 signed-by=/usr/share/keyrings/docker-archive-keyring.gpg] https://download.docker.com/linux/debian \ + $(lsb_release -cs) stable" | sudo tee /etc/apt/sources.list.d/docker.list > /dev/null # JNI build dependencies w/ 32-bit compatible C libs RUN apt-get update -qq && \ apt-get -y install docker-engine make gcc file lib32stdc++6 lib32z1 && \ diff --git a/docker/android-sdk/Dockerfile b/docker/android-sdk/Dockerfile index 5820dd63..20ae2c48 100644 --- a/docker/android-sdk/Dockerfile +++ b/docker/android-sdk/Dockerfile @@ -13,8 +13,10 @@ ENV DEBIAN_FRONTEND noninteractive RUN apt-get update -qq && \ apt-get -y dist-upgrade && \ apt-get -y install gnupg apt-transport-https -RUN echo 'deb https://download.docker.com/linux/debian debian-stretch stable' > /etc/apt/sources.list.d/docker.list && \ - curl -s https://download.docker.com/linux/debian/gpg | apt-key add - +RUN curl -fsSL https://download.docker.com/linux/debian/gpg | sudo gpg --dearmor -o /usr/share/keyrings/docker-archive-keyring.gpg && \ + echo \ + "deb [arch=amd64 signed-by=/usr/share/keyrings/docker-archive-keyring.gpg] https://download.docker.com/linux/debian \ + $(lsb_release -cs) stable" | sudo tee /etc/apt/sources.list.d/docker.list > /dev/null RUN apt-get update -qq && \ apt-get install -y docker-engine \ # the basics |